/// <summary> /// Performs a <see cref="IAccessoryMounter.CanMount"/> check on the mounters and returns the index of the /// first one that returns true, or -1 if none was found. /// </summary> /// <param name="accessory">The accessory. (Required)</param> /// <param name="location">The location.</param> /// <param name="restrictions">The body converage restrictions.</param> /// <returns>The index of the mounter than can mount the accessory, or -1 if none was found.</returns> public int CanMount(Accessory accessory, MountPoint location, BodyCoverage restrictions) { for (int i = 0; i < Count; i++) { if (Accessory.CanMount(accessory, this[i], location, restrictions)) { return(i); } } return(-1); }
